Description
19 Linden Court, Kennedy Park presents an excellent opportunity to acquire a well-located two-bedroom mid-terrace home within easy reach of Limerick City Centre. Situated on a quiet laneway, this property offers superb convenience alongside strong renovation potential, making it an ideal starter home or investment property.
Accommodation comprises an entrance living room with kitchen/dining area to the rear at ground floor level, while upstairs includes two bedrooms and a main bathroom. The property is in fair condition throughout and offers significant scope for modernisation and energy efficiency upgrades.
Externally, the home features a small rear yard with two block built sheds and valuable rear pedestrian access and off-street parking.
The location is exceptionally convenient, within walking distance of Limerick City Centre, Colbert Train & Bus Station, and Roxboro Shopping Centre. Excellent connectivity is provided via nearby public transport links, while the M7 motorway network is easily accessible, connecting Limerick to Dublin, Shannon and the wider Mid-West region.
This property will appeal to first-time buyers seeking an affordable city home as well as investors looking for a property with strong rental potential and scope to add value through refurbishment.
